Abstract

A device and a method for providing programs to multiple end user devices. The method includes: providing to multiple end user devices, via an edge device, at least one type of media stream out of unicast media stream and a multicast media stream; wherein the at least one type of media stream convey a group of programs; receiving a request from a first end user device to view a first program that belongs to the group of programs; and selectively switching, in response to bandwidth constraints imposed on a communication path coupled to the edge device, a type of a media stream that conveys the first program to a second end user device.
